PETITION FOR ANTICIPATORY BAIL Under Sec. 438 Cr.P.C. ORDER : The Court Made the following order :- The petitioners, who apprehend arrest at the hands of the respondent police for the offences punishable under Sections 294(b), 448, 324 and 506(ii) I.P.C, in Crime No.173 of 2018, seek anticipatory bail.
2.The case of the prosecution is that the defacto complainant is running a Hero Showroom at Sayalkudi to Thoothukudi Road. On 12.10.2018 the petitioners went to the defacto complainant's shop and asked about the vehicle quotation. At that time, there was a wordy quarrel arose between them. Due to that, the petitioners assaulted the defacto complainant. Thereby, he sustained injuries. Hence, the complaint.
3.Heard the learned counsel appearing for the petitioners. 4.The learned Additional Public Prosecutor submitted that the injured has been discharged from the hospital. https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/ 5.Taking note of the facts and circumstances, this Court is inclined to grant anticipatory bail to the petitioners with certain
conditions. Accordingly, the petitioners are ordered to be released on bail in the event of arrest or on their appearance before the learned Judicial Magistrate, Muthukulathur and on their executing a bond for a sum of Rs.10,000/- (Rupees Ten Thousand only) each with two sureties each for a like sum to the satisfaction of the learned Magistrate concerned and on further condition that the petitioners shall appear before the respondent police as and when required for interrogation. The petitioners shall comply with the conditions stipulated under Section 438 Cr.P.C. scrupulously. 6.The petitioners shall appear before the concerned Magistrate within a period of 15 days from the date on which the order copy made ready, failing which, the petition for anticipatory bail shall stand dismissed.
